Tuesday Evening Weather Update

After another round of rain and strong storms on the Eastern Plains, we will finally dry out by Wednesday morning. Wednesday morning will start cool and dry with tmeperatures in the mid-40s.

Overall Wednesday will be a nice day with highs rising to more normal levels in the upper 70s for much of the area. There is a slight chance of afternoon storms but those should be confined to the higher elevations and no severe weather is expected.

Our trend for the remainder of the week shows that temperatures will be warming to above normal by Friday with highs reaching well into the 80s and possibly 90s for some. Thunderstorm chances decrease through the week as well but we bring back the chance for afternoon storms for this weekend and a more typical summer-time pattern sets in.

Overall, youre extended forecast looks a lot more like a June forecast should so enjoy the nice weather and for the first time in awhile, stay cool out there!
